What next for EV in Wales?The Welsh Government consults on building regulations changes for electric vehicle charging pointsSeptember 12, 2024 Why should I read this?Anyone planning on building in Wales should make themselves aware of the proposals. They affect new buildings, whether residential or non-residential, and existing buildings which are undergoing major renovation or material change of use. The aim is to require a minimum number of electric vehicle charging points by reference to the number of parking spaces. For some residential buildings, this could be as much as a charging point for every parking space. What should I do?
What else do I need to know?The consultation will run until 29 November 2024. The consultation paper is clear that electrical vehicles form a key part of Welsh green policy. There is a real advantage to being an earlier adopter who can help shape the rollout rather than reacting to what someone else has set. Developers who act early can use their strong position to secure a new, revenue generating asset class rather than wait for strict obligations to shift the power balance towards EV charging point operators. There are currently different legal models in the market, allowing developers to choose what works for them. As time goes by, operators are likely to dictate terms more forcefully.
